Piazza Armerina

Province of Enna

Piazza Armerina is known for its mosaics and its famous Palio dei Normanni festival, one of the most impressive  reconstruction of medieval history in South Italy.

Guglielmo d’Altavilla destroyed the old village of Piazza Armerina in 1161 crossing out any sign of the old civilisations who marked the land. Today this charming town is known for its mosaics and its famous Palio dei Normanni festival, one of the most impressive  reconstruction of medieval history in South Italy.

Thanks to the amazing climate, mild in winter and cool in the summer, this village is an ideal destination at any point during your travel through Sicily.
Piazza Armerina has many churches and ancient buildings like the Villa Romana, who with its stunning and precious mosaics became a UNESCO World Heritage site after being declared a “supreme example of a luxury villa which illustrates the social and economic structure of its age”. Imposing and majestic, it dominates the entire village from the top of the hill. Built in Baroque style, it was established on the ruins of the old Mother Church, it includes important works of art, precious marbles and old holy vestments. The oldest church of the village is Chiesa Del Priorato di Sant’Andrea  which is considered one of the most interesting work of the Sicilian Medieval art thanks to its architecture and its paintings.
